Expert Verdict
β-Asarone content depends on culture conditions and must be analytically verified per batch; no SCCS opinion specific to this ingredient

Is Acorus Calamus Callus Culture Extract allowed in the EU?
Acorus Calamus Callus Culture Extract EU regulatory status: permitted. This is based on EU Regulation 1223/2009 and its amendments.
What does Acorus Calamus Callus Culture Extract do in cosmetics?
Acorus Calamus Callus Culture Extract functions as: Skin Conditioning. It is classified as a cosmetic ingredient in our database. CAS number: Not commonly assigned (cell culture–derived).
